Three days of national mourning have been announced.
Hospitals were reportedly overwhelmed, and Henry said medical teams were being dispatched to the area.
The deputy mayor of Cap-Haitien, Patrick Almonor, told the AP that roughly 20 homes were burned, over 100 people were injured and at least 53 people died, but he expects the number of fatalities to rise as they account for those who died in their homes.“It’s the first time since I’ve been a firefighter in over 17 years that I have lived such a catastrophe,” Frandy Jean, head of firefighters for northern Haiti, told theHaiti is largely dependent on generators for its power.
